Auto industry analysis website TrueCar, Inc., offers car buyers a simple promise: by visiting TrueCar.com, you will find better information on what people in your area have been paying for cars than you would on your own. TrueCar leverages its access to information on car sales and industry trends to compile a range of statistics with the goal of helping car buyers find the best deals.

In May 2013, the site reported that ratings for its TrueMPG measure of fuel efficiency had leveled and were showing a year-over-year gain of 0.4 miles per gallon. One of the company’s analysts explained that high fuel prices were pushing consumers toward purchasing models with better gas mileage and that even larger, less-efficient models were showing improvements.

TrueCar’s report also broke down gas mileage numbers by manufacturer and region. U.S. manufacturers trailed their counterparts in Europe and Japan in average fuel mileage ratings, while cars from South Korean manufacturers boasted the highest average TrueMPG, at 27.3 miles per gallon. TrueCar calculates TrueMPG by using the mileage ratings applied to each vehicle by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ency and weighting them by monthly sales.
